fre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

計(jì)算機(jī)設(shè)備管理相關(guān)資料-展示頁(yè)

2025-02-21 16:52本頁(yè)面
  

【正文】 設(shè)備控制器的組成 數(shù)據(jù)寄存器控制/狀態(tài)寄存器I/O邏輯控制器與設(shè)備接口1控制器與設(shè)備接口2數(shù)據(jù)線地址線控制線CPU與控制器接口??數(shù)據(jù)狀態(tài)控制數(shù)據(jù)狀態(tài)控制控制器與設(shè)備接口 ?設(shè)備控制器的主要任務(wù) 1)接收和識(shí)別命令 2)數(shù)據(jù)交換 3)了解設(shè)備的狀態(tài) 4)地址識(shí)別 設(shè)備通道 ?雖然設(shè)備控制器可以對(duì)設(shè)備進(jìn)行控制,但當(dāng)外設(shè)很多時(shí), CPU負(fù)擔(dān)過重,為此在 CPU與控制器之間增加 設(shè)備通道 , 實(shí)現(xiàn)對(duì)所有外設(shè)的統(tǒng)一管理。 設(shè)備間的差異 ?數(shù)據(jù)率 ? 管理程序 ? 控制的復(fù)雜度 ? 數(shù)據(jù)的傳送單位 ? 數(shù)據(jù)編碼 ? 出錯(cuò)條件 設(shè)備控制器 設(shè)備控制器或適配器 是 I/O設(shè)備的電子部分,它是 CPU與 I/O設(shè)備之間的接口,它接收從 CPU發(fā)來的命令,并控制 I/O設(shè)備工作。 字符設(shè)備 :鍵盤、行式打印機(jī)。 ? 在設(shè)備控制器中設(shè)置控制 /狀態(tài)寄存器 I/O 設(shè)備管理概述 I/O管理的功能 ?監(jiān)視設(shè)備的狀態(tài) ?進(jìn)行設(shè)備分配 ?完成 I/O操作 ?緩沖管理 總線型 I/O系統(tǒng)結(jié)構(gòu) 圖形控制器橋/ 內(nèi)存控制器SCS I磁 盤控制器 擴(kuò)展總線接口? 其 它 控 制器打印機(jī)磁盤PCI 總線監(jiān)視器處理器高速緩存內(nèi)存 磁盤IDE 磁盤控制器磁盤磁盤擴(kuò)展總線并行端口 串行端口鍵盤 I/O設(shè)備類型 塊設(shè)備 :磁盤、磁帶,塊大小 512B~32KB, 通常為 512B。 I/O接口 計(jì)算機(jī)與 I/O設(shè)備或其他系統(tǒng)之間的邏輯控制部件。 ? 并行傳輸 :每位數(shù)據(jù)需要一根數(shù)據(jù)線,多位數(shù)據(jù)一起傳輸。 總線的數(shù)據(jù)傳輸方式 ? 串行傳輸 :每次傳送一位,只需一根數(shù)據(jù)線。 CPU 主存 I/O接口 I/O接口 外設(shè) 1 外設(shè) n 系統(tǒng)總線 CPU和主存之間的數(shù)據(jù)交換通過專用總線進(jìn)行,減輕了系統(tǒng)總線的負(fù)擔(dān)。 ,但任何時(shí)刻都只能由一個(gè)設(shè)備向總線發(fā)送信息,所以對(duì)總線的使用需要協(xié)調(diào)。 ? 完成總線上各功能部件之間的數(shù)據(jù)傳送。 ? 通信總線 :計(jì)算機(jī)系統(tǒng)之間或計(jì)算機(jī)系統(tǒng)與外部設(shè)備之間的信息傳送線。 總線分類 ? CPU內(nèi)部總線 :寄存器之間,寄存器與 ALU之間。第六章 設(shè)備管理 ● I/O接口 ● 磁盤管理 ● I/O控制方式 ● 緩沖管理 ● 系統(tǒng)總線 系統(tǒng)總線 總線基本概念和分類 ? 兩兩部件獨(dú)立相連,相互通信時(shí)雙方必須停止其他工作,降低了部件的工作效率; ? 隨著計(jì)算機(jī)部件的增多,內(nèi)部連線非常復(fù)雜,不利于系統(tǒng)設(shè)備的擴(kuò)展。 ? 總線是計(jì)算機(jī)中各個(gè)通信模塊共享的,用來在這些部件之間傳送信息的一組導(dǎo)線和相關(guān)的控制和接口部件。 ? 系統(tǒng)總線 : CPU與主存或 I/O設(shè)備之間的信息傳送線,又稱為外總線。 系統(tǒng)總線的組成 ? 傳送主存單元地址或者 I/O設(shè)備的端口地址。 ? 傳送定時(shí)信號(hào)和命令信息,以實(shí)現(xiàn)對(duì)設(shè)備的控制和監(jiān)視。 系統(tǒng)總線的結(jié)構(gòu) 任何兩個(gè)部件之間可以直接進(jìn)行信息交流,提高了計(jì)算 機(jī)的靈活性和工作效率,但由于總線是臨界資源,單總線 會(huì)增加總線負(fù)載,影響操作速度。 CPU 主存 I/O接口 I/O接口 外設(shè) 1 外設(shè) n 系統(tǒng)總線 存儲(chǔ)總線 CPU 主存 I/O接口 I/O接口 外設(shè) 1 外設(shè) n 通道 系統(tǒng)總線 存儲(chǔ)總線 I/O總線 通道又稱為 I/O處理機(jī),統(tǒng)一管理外部設(shè)備,實(shí)現(xiàn)主存與外設(shè)之間的數(shù)據(jù)傳輸,分擔(dān)了 CPU的部分功能。適用于慢速設(shè)備,如鍵盤、鼠標(biāo)等。 ? 注意: 總線和設(shè)備接口之間總是以并行方式傳送數(shù)據(jù),但設(shè)備和接口之間可能以并行方式,也可能以串行方式。 接 口 控 制 器 I/O 標(biāo) 準(zhǔn) 接 口 設(shè) 備 控 制 器 I/O 設(shè) 備 外圍設(shè)備與主機(jī)的連接 設(shè)備地址線 控制、狀態(tài)線 數(shù)據(jù)線 CPU ? 實(shí)現(xiàn)主機(jī)與外圍設(shè)備間的通信和控制; ? 設(shè)備的選擇,操作時(shí)序的協(xié)調(diào),中斷請(qǐng)求與批準(zhǔn) ? 實(shí)現(xiàn)數(shù)據(jù)緩沖,使主機(jī)與外設(shè)的工作速度匹配; ? 在設(shè)備控制器中設(shè)置一個(gè)或多個(gè)數(shù)據(jù)緩沖寄存器 ? 接收主機(jī)的命令,提供設(shè)備和接口的狀態(tài)。 塊設(shè)備的特點(diǎn)是速度快、可隨機(jī)訪問 。特點(diǎn)是速度低、不可尋址、 I/O采用中斷驅(qū)動(dòng) 。通常一臺(tái)控制器可控制多臺(tái)同一類型的設(shè)備。 ?設(shè)備通道是特殊的處理機(jī) ?指令單一 ?沒有內(nèi)存 通道的連接方式 計(jì)算機(jī)I/O通道1I/O通道2控制器控制器控制器控制器設(shè)備計(jì)算機(jī)I/O通道1I/O通道2設(shè)備設(shè)備設(shè)備設(shè)備控制器1控制器2.........?單通路 ?多通路 –設(shè)備與計(jì)算機(jī)之間有多條通道,增加靈活性。某通道、控制器壞,也不會(huì)影響數(shù)據(jù)交換。 衡量數(shù)據(jù)傳送控制方式原則 ? 數(shù)據(jù)傳送速度高 ? 系統(tǒng)開銷小 ? 充分發(fā)揮硬件資源的能力, I/O設(shè)備忙, CPU等待時(shí)間少 程序直接控制方式 由用戶進(jìn)程直接控制 CPU與外設(shè)之間的信息傳送。 ?CPU在一段時(shí)間內(nèi)只能與一臺(tái)外設(shè)交換數(shù)據(jù)信息 。 中斷驅(qū)動(dòng)方式 為了減少程序直接控制方式中 CPU的等待時(shí)間 ,提高系統(tǒng)并行工作的程度 。 發(fā)指令啟動(dòng)外設(shè)將中斷位置1收到中斷信號(hào)嗎?中斷處理被中斷進(jìn)程繼續(xù)執(zhí)行CPU是否接到啟動(dòng)命令數(shù)據(jù)寄存器滿嗎?控制器發(fā)中斷信號(hào)外設(shè)是否將數(shù)據(jù)送到數(shù)據(jù)寄存器(a)(b)進(jìn)程調(diào)度程序調(diào)度其它進(jìn)程其它進(jìn)程執(zhí)行 中斷驅(qū)動(dòng)方式的缺點(diǎn): ?由于數(shù)據(jù)寄存器只能存放一個(gè)字節(jié) , 造成中斷次數(shù)過多 。 DMA控制方式 中斷方式比程序 I/O方式有效,但它是以字節(jié)為單位進(jìn)行的,且 CPU對(duì) I/O的干預(yù)頻繁。 DMA控制器的組成 增加兩類寄存器: ?內(nèi)存地址寄存器 MAR ?數(shù)據(jù)計(jì)數(shù)器 DC CPU控制器控制/狀態(tài)寄存器內(nèi)存地址寄存器忙/閑位 中斷位開始中斷數(shù)據(jù)線信號(hào)線數(shù)據(jù)寄存器數(shù)據(jù)計(jì)數(shù)器內(nèi)存Count DMA工作過程 存儲(chǔ)器地址增1數(shù)據(jù)計(jì)數(shù)器減1挪用存儲(chǔ)器周期傳送數(shù)據(jù)字開始設(shè)置MAR和DC的初值啟動(dòng)DMA傳送命令DC=0?是在繼續(xù)執(zhí)行用戶程序的同時(shí),準(zhǔn)備又一次傳送請(qǐng)求中斷否● 當(dāng) CPU需要從磁盤讀數(shù)據(jù)時(shí),便向磁盤控制器 DMA發(fā)命令 ● 該命令送命令寄存器 CR
點(diǎn)擊復(fù)制文檔內(nèi)容
教學(xué)課件相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1